The main BRIT Awards TV show usually runs for about 2 to 2.5 hours, including ad breaks.
Quick Scoop: How long are the BRIT Awards?
For recent years, the televised ceremony on ITV (or its streaming equivalent) typically:
- Starts around 8:00 pm UK time.
- Finishes around 10:00–10:30 pm UK time.
So if you’re planning your evening, expect:
- Roughly 120–150 minutes for the main show.
- Extra time if you include:
- Red carpet coverage beforehand.
- Post‑show clips, interviews, and social content.
A simple rule of thumb: block out about 3 hours total if you want to watch the red carpet build‑up plus the full ceremony.
Why the timing can vary
- Live performances and surprise moments sometimes push the show slightly over its planned slot.
- In past years, speeches and long performances have even been cut short when the ceremony started to overrun.
TL;DR: The BRIT Awards ceremony itself is around 2–2.5 hours, but a full evening with build‑up and extras can easily stretch to about 3 hours.
